I am Professor of Clinical Pharmacy and Director of the Âé¶¹´«Ã½ NIHR Patient Safety Research Collaboration. I was a pharmacist for 32 years and retired from the GPhC register in 2024. I have a background in hospital pharmacy practice and have held a range of academic posts at both the University of Sunderland and Durham University. I have experience of leading a School of Pharmacy for over 17 years and have worked with the General Pharmaceutical Council, Pharmaceutical Society of Northern Ireland and the General Optical Council on statutory accreditation and high stakes assessment as a chair and a member of the the accreditation teams and the Board of Assessors.
My research interests primarily focus on the safe and effective use of medicines and how prescribing decisions influence patient care. This currently extends into examining how medicines are discontinued when no longer appropriate and how clinical review of prescribed medicines can influence patient outcomes, including readmission to hospital. Adherence to prescribed medication is also of interest particularly in the context of how individual disease states and social backgrounds influence patients decisions to adhere to their treatments.
More recently, I have developed numerous strands of research examining how minority communities can manage their medicines safely and effectively, we are interested in how these communities are able to access healthcare services and how services are designed to address the needs of these communities.

My research interests focus on the safe and effective use of medicines, including understanding the impact of polypharmacy and examining different approaches to reducing the burden of medicines for patients or constructing support mechanisms to ensure that medicines are used safely, particularly for those patients who are prescribed larger numbers of medicines resulting in polypharmacy or hyperpolypharmacy. Within this, I am also interested in understand more about the intersection between long-term diseases and polypharmacy and how particular combinations of disease and medicines conveys increased risk.
We are interesting in minoritisation and how patients experience healthcare when they are part of minority communities in the UK. Our research suggests that we do need to understand how to design healthcare interventions for different communities, rather than simply amending what already exists. We are working to understand how we need to design and deliver healthcare interventions for those people who are members of minority communities and who are also are less affluent. Recent projects include examining medicines adherence within minority communities to understand what are the key drivers that result in poor adherence to prescribed treatments.
The rational use of medicines, primarily in the hospital environment and in palliative care will continue to be part of my research portfolio. This area is focused on prescribing and deprescribing and the consequences thereof, including medicines-related readmission to hospital and the use of IT to support prescribing and decision-making. We are interested in understanding more about interventions, which will improve safe prescribing, but also ensure regular, timely review in order to improve patient outcomes. The use of medicines as patients age is a specific area of interest currently patients are prescribed a medicine and told they will need to take it of the rest of their life. What does this mean in ageing patients or those with life-limiting illness, how do patient perceive deprescribing and how can this be safely and systematically approached? These are the questions we are currently addressing within this group.
I teach on the Master of Pharmacy programme (MPharm) primarily in the area of clinical therapeutics. My main area of interest is in haematology and I also support the Stage 1 anatomy teaching. I have extensive expertise in assessment design, including the use of blueprinting and standard setting to create valid and reliable assessment tools.
I supervise Master's projects associated with the MPharm, these projects usually focus on the safe and effective use of medicines in different communities of people as well as hospital pharmacy-related topics around admission and readmission to hospital as a consequence of medicine-related issues.
At present, I lead the Integrated Report assessment at Stage 1 of the MPharm and the Literature Review assessment at Stage 3.
